Equal Employment Opportunity Statement

It is our policy to afford equal opportunity as required by law to all qualified persons and applicants for employment, based on their qualifications without regard to race, color, sex, religion, national origin, physical disabilities, age, or veteran status. This obligation includes recruitment, advertising, solicitation for employment, hiring, training, education, placement, promotion, transfers, demotion and termination, compensation and benefits, social and recreational activities.

Staff Philosophy

Our office is dedicated to providing our patients with the highest quality ophthalmological care. Every decision and every action by our employees should be aimed toward this goal. We believe that our patients are our most important asset. Without them we would have no purpose. We place great importance on remembering our patients’ names and on treating them with courtesy, fairness, and respect. We believe that our employees are the heart of our practice. The qualities which they convey to our patients have an impact much greater than our office decor, our building, or our equipment. We believe that there is no place for rudeness by members of our staff. The ability to remain cheerful under pressure is equally important as attaining the maximum technical skill. We should strive at all times to be gracious and accommodating, both to our patients and to our fellow employees.

It is our desire to have only staff members who will work together with a sincere spirit of cooperation and teamwork. We believe this is a key ingredient not only in the success of our practice but in promoting a pleasant and rewarding work environment for our employees as well. We want our practice to be at the forefront of our profession.

The purpose of this handbook is to provide you with information that will assist you in performing your job. This manual is not a contract, and nothing in this handbook or any oral statements can or should be construed as a contract of employment, implied or otherwise. The corporation has the right to amend this handbook at any time without further notice.

All employees are employed not by contract, but at will. This means that you and the corporation are each free to terminate the employment relationship at any time without notice for any reason or for no reason at all. Nothing in this handbook should in any way be interpreted to alter this employment at will relationship.
